FTP Script

Hello ; )

I need help to make 2 ftp script in one ... this will be, for me, faster to use on day to day ...

I am on solaris 9 and I am using KSH.

All ftp script are just connecting to ftp server and show files in directory, that's it.

The scripts build a .netrc file to get the connection.

Here is what I did, but it's not working. THanks in advanced for your help.


Code:
# VARIABLES FTP SITE 1
FTP_1=IP_ADRESS
USERNAME_IN_1=usename
PASSIN_1='password'

# VARIABLES FTP SITE 2
FTP_2=IP_ADRESS
USERNAME_IN_2=username
PASSIN_2="password"

# VARIABLES PACTE
USERNAME_PC=username
PASSPC=password

# PHASE 1

if [ $# -lt 1 ] ; then
# Build  .netrc
cat > ~/.netrc <<EOF
machine machine_name
login $USERNAME_PC
password "$PASSPC"
macdef init
quote site $FTP_1
user $USERNAME_IN_1 $PASSIN_1
prompt off
pwd
dir
cd download
ls -lrt
quit


EOF
else
  echo " usage : error "
  exit
fi


# Go On ftp
chmod og-r ~/.netrc
ftp machine_name
\rm ~/.netrc

# PHASE 2


if [ $# -lt 1 ] ; then
# Build .netrc
cat > ~/.netrc <<EOF
machine machine_name
login $USERNAME_PC
password "$PASSPC"
macdef init
quote site $FTP_2
user $USERNAME_IN_2 $PASSIN_2
prompt
cd pub/test/testing
dir "*P_SK*"
pwd
quit

EOF
else
  echo " error "
  exit
fi


# execution du ftp
chmod og-r ~/.netrc
ftp machine_name
\rm ~/.netrc

I cannot comment on macdef (never used it).
The login details line in a .netrc file is like this (all on the same line):
Code:
machine machine_name login $USERNAME_PC password "$PASSPC"

Also a .netrc file should have permissions 600 . See man .netrc.
The whole idea of the .netrc file is that you do not have plain text passwords in the script, so creating the .netrc file in a script defeats the object.
